I believe that the spirit of this rule is to prevent people choosing to die for no purpose, by intentionally overheating in a corner of the map by themselves. For people wanting to suicide, telling them 'out of bounds' was unacceptable meant they also needed to cover any other way to suicide with a useless death.
While I'm sure a ruleslawyer would say that the words leave it open to interpretation, I can't see any dev siding with them. You were playing, and chose to take the other guy out, at the cost of your mech. You weren't violating the spirit of that rule.
Hell, I'm constantly hitting override (or coming out of shutdown early) to keep on plugging away. Sometimes those extra few alphas actually make ALL the difference in turning a roll into an even match again.
